Activists are pleased by Cook forest budget

Posted on November 29, 2005

Chicago Tribune

This article discusses the comments that were made at the public hearings of the Forest Preserve District of Cook County regarding their FY2006 proposed budget. It cites the Civic Federation’s outspoken opposition to the proposed budget on the grounds that the budget book lacks sufficient details of spending to justify an 8.5 percent property tax increase in Cook County and that the District’s capital improvement program lacks transparency and public involvement.
